Prediction, pick for Alycia Baumgardner vs. Leila Beaudoin

Ryan Wohl gives his best bet for Alycia Baumgardner vs. Leila Beaudoin at tonight’s boxing card on Netflix.
The IBF and WBO Women’s Super Featherweight Champion, Alycia Baumgardner, is back to defend her titles against Leila Beaudoin in the co-main event of tonight’s boxing card on Netflix. In this contest, both fighters have one career loss: Baumgardner is 16-1, while Beaudoin is 13-1. Baumgardner is currently on an 11-fight unbeaten streak since her last loss, as Beaudoin has won four consecutive bouts.

Alycia Baumgardner is the best women’s fighter at Super Featherweight and is coming off a victory against Jennifer Miranda in July. She has held gold for a long time, as she has been champion at 130 pounds since 2021. Even though Beaudoin is ranked as the No. 4 contender in this division on BoxRec, she isn’t as proven as Baumgardner.
Since joining Most Valuable Promotions, Jake Paul and Nikisa Bidarian have done a tremendous job of highlighting their elite female roster, including Baumgardner. Baumgardner signed with MVP in March and since competed at The World’s Most Famous Arena, Madison Square Garden, in July.
On DraftKings Sportsbook, Baumgardner is a massive -1400 to win this fight while Beaudoin is a +750 underdog. Baumgardner has won seven fights by knockout in her career, but hasn’t scored one since 2021. With her last five wins having been by decision, getting her at -200 to win on the judges’ scorecards is a much better value play than by moneyline.
Beaudoin is talented but lacks the championship experience Baumgardner has. This is Baumgardner’s eighth consecutive world title fight. Baumgardner is an elite defensive boxer, as opponents land only 7.6 punches per round at a 22 percent rate, according to CompuBox. If Baumgardner is the aggressor while displaying elite defense, another dominant performance is likely.
